Handover note — Eventspine schema registry. Plugin authors publishing to Eventspine must register their event schemas before the first deploy; unregistered payloads are dropped silently at the broker. Validation runs on push, so breaking changes fail fast. I've been approving new namespaces manually; that duty now passes to Renna on the Platform Guild. Compatibility rules and the namespace request form are documented on the internal page below.

wiki page, fajof-tajef: https://vault.tolvaqio.corp/board/pipeline/pages/ticket/c20d7f984bcc9e12

Ticket #4182 — Bulk edits in Ledgerline admin table skip audit log

Hey, noticed that selecting 50+ rows and hitting "apply to all" writes changes without per-row audit entries. Single edits log fine. Security folks: this probably matters for the compliance review. Repro is trivial on staging. The affected build's trace token is right below.

session token of kahif-kageg = htk14_01cd78718aea51

# Sweeper Environments — Tidewrack Orphan Sweeper

The sweeper runs in three environments: sandbox, staging, and production. Each has its own deletion grace period and dry-run default; production never hard-deletes without a quorum flag. Future maintainers should never copy production settings into sandbox, as the resource graphs differ. For reference, the staging environment currently operates with the following configuration.

service settings:
novath:
  pin: 1396
  tenant: pelys
  seal: seal_ccc035e1
  metrics_host: metrics.novath.qorvelworks.test
  standby_team: fraeth
  escalation: drueth-zorok
  nonce: 61d508